Design

The amount of different devices now accessing the Internet has caused web design in London to change. Access to the Internet with mobile and tablet devices looks set to overtake that of desktop computers. Web design must now address how a website will look and perform on multiple devices and screen sizes. New technology allows us to create responsive frameworks that reposition and reorganize content for optimum display and user experience.

Technology

A business can establish itself online for relatively little cost thanks to reduced hardware and software costs. The price of web design in London is now significantly cheaper as a result of cheaper technology. Thanks to open source packages like Magento and WordPress, web development is also a fraction of the cost it was 10 years ago. It is no longer necessary to build applications from scratch as most components required for the development of a website are freely available. Open source packages provide the key building blocks of a website and can be modified to suit the majority of requirements. Although some projects require complex programming, much of our time is now spent on design and integration.

Internet

Thanks to faster Internet speeds the type of content that can be displayed on websites has changed. In the past web designers would steer away from images as they would take a long time to load and would affect the time it took for users to access web content. Nowadays with faster Internet speeds London web design features much more exciting layouts that can include video and large images.
